| Reverse description | The reverse field is divided into two registers by a horizontal rule and carries a multi-line Arabic inscription in Naskh script. The upper register displays a bold, sweeping legend occupying the full width of the field, while the lower register bears the partial dynastic attribution reading بن محمود شاه ('son of Mahmud Shah'), identifying the issuing sultan's lineage. The lettering is deeply struck with characteristic thick strokes, consistent with the hammered billon coinage of the Gujarat Sultanate under Shams al-Din Muzaffar Shah III. |
